As in how much reading, how long are the papers, how it fits in with all the other work etc., etc. Thanks!Can't give you any help there, as my cohort won't be starting the bioethics class until August when you guys start! All I can say is that the price difference is HUGE and that if you're not taking bioethics during the 2nd semester, then you have more free time during the week to study for other classes. Everyone who I talked to before I started the program said to take the Taylor course if I could, because it would be worth it. No one in the program recommended or encouraged me (or anyone else as far as I know) to take the bioethics class at mount saint mary's during the 2nd semester.
Based off of my experiences so far, I completely understand why everyone says to take that class ahead of time. Your free time in the program will be next to nothing. Only reason why I've been posting every so often is because I've been taking a study break at that time. When you're not in class or clinicals, you're driving to/from these places or studying for something. In 6 weeks we've had 5 (?) tests already (I think.... I stopped counting) and 2 finals next week. Plus competency exams. There is always something to be studying, care plans that have to be written, etc.
